Rajani Duganna

Rajani Duganna is an Indian politician and former Mayor of Mangalore City Corporation. She took office on 26 February 2010, with B. Rajendra Kumar as Deputy Mayor. She is the fifth female to have become mayor of the city corporation, as well as its 24th mayor, since the corporation's establishment in 1984.[1] She is a Dalit and belongs to the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P).[1] Duganna was succeeded as Mayor by her cousin Praveen Kumar on 28 February 2011.[2]
